Background technology
Along with the appearance of the development of large scale integrated circuit technology, particularly single-chip microcomputer, there is the intelligent cipher lock being with microprocessor, for the innovation of conventional mechanical door lock industry brings power.On-mechanical key comprises iris recognition access control system, magnetic card, radio-frequency card or TM card (TouchMemoryCard; contact storage card) etc.; different on-mechanical keys also exists different features; such as; iris recognition access control system belongs to bio-identification class, and security is high, does not exist to lose to damage; but be inconvenient to configure, cost is high; Magnetic card or radio-frequency card belong to noncontact class, and security is higher, plastic material, and configuration is carried more convenient, cheap; TM card is contact class, and security is very high, stainless steel, and it is very convenient that configuration is carried, and price is lower.These technology reduce the dependence that physics is unblanked, and make smart lock except the unlocking function with conventional door lock, have also possessed the function of intelligent management, thus make door lock have very high security, reliability, also make it apply increasingly extensive.
Biometrics identification technology is at present convenient, safe identity recognizing technology, identification be people itself, do not need the marker outside body.Biometrics identification technology utilizes the physiological characteristic of people and behavioural characteristic to carry out identification, mainly contains fingerprint recognition, recognition of face, iris recognition, Gait Recognition etc., hand vein recognition, personal recognition.In numerous biometrics identification technologies, current fingerprint recognition is the most ripe, applies also extensive.Personal recognition technology is the method utilizing staff palm patterned feature to carry out identity verify.Palm print characteristics region area is large, comprises quantity of information many, comprises main line, fold, minutiae point and trigpoint etc.Palm print characteristics has the feature such as uniqueness, stability, not easily forgery; Personal recognition image acquisition is also very convenient, and easy detected person accepts, cost is low, discrimination is high.Based on the authentication identifying method of palmmprint; can meet personal identification identification system technical indicator (uniqueness, in real time reliable, precision is high, anti-tamper security, protection privacy); now methodical limitation can be overcome again; can say, personal recognition technology has become based on the new research and apply field of biometric identity authentication technique.
But also there is following problem in above-mentioned intelligent door lock, first, warning warning cannot be carried out, the second to repeatedly appearing at the people before intelligent door lock, cannot on-hook process be carried out to the phenomenon of constantly touch-control intelligent door lock, 3rd, the most power consumption of existing intelligent door lock is higher.

Embodiment
The technical matters solved to make the utility model, technical scheme and beneficial effect are clearly understood, below in conjunction with drawings and Examples, are further elaborated to the utility model.Should be appreciated that specific embodiment described herein only in order to explain the utility model, and be not used in restriction the utility model.
As shown in Figures 1 to 4, a kind of intelligent door lock that the utility model embodiment provides, comprise: human body infrared detection module 1, touch control detection module 2, processing module 3, power module 4, door lock main frame 5 and alarm module 6, power module 4 is electrically connected with human body infrared detection module 1, touch control detection module 2, processing module 3 and door lock main frame 5 respectively, and processing module 3 is electrically connected with human body infrared detection module 1, touch control detection module 2, door lock main frame 5 and alarm module 6 respectively; Wherein,
Human body infrared detection module 1, for detecting outside human body information, and when outside human body information being detected, generating and detecting that the detection signal of outside human body information sends to processing module 3;
Touch control detection module 2, for detecting outside touching signals, and when outside touching signals being detected, generating and detecting that the detection signal of outside touching signals sends to processing module 3;
Processing module 3, for receiving the detection signal that human body infrared detection module 1 sends, and when human body infrared detection module 1 send detect that the frequency of the detection signal of outside human body information exceedes default detection frequency domain value time, generating control power module 4 provides the control signal of power supply to send to power module 4 to alarm module 6, after control signal is sent to power module 4, the control signal that generation control alarm module 6 carries out reporting to the police sends to alarm module 6;
Processing module 3 is also for receiving the detection signal that touch control detection module 2 sends, and when touch control detection module 2 send detect that the frequency of the detection signal of outside touching signals exceedes default touch-control frequency domain value time, generate and control power module 4 and stop providing the control signal of power supply to send to power module 4 to door lock main frame 5;
Power module 4 is for providing power supply for human body infrared detection module 1, touch control detection module 2, processing module 3 and door lock main frame 5, and provide the control signal of power supply to provide power supply to alarm module 6 to alarm module 6, to start alarm module 6 according to the control power module 4 that processing module 3 sends;
The control power module 4 of power module 4 also for sending according to processing module 3 stops providing the control signal of power supply to stop providing power supply to door lock main frame 5, so that door lock main frame 5 on-hook to door lock main frame 5;
Door lock main frame 5, for carrying out authentication with the Intelligent key of outside, and complete by with the authentication of described Intelligent key after, by encryption after unlocking cipher be sent to Intelligent key, and response it is received decipher through Intelligent key the unlocking cipher obtained, unblock door lock;
Alarm module 6, the control signal that the control alarm module 6 for sending according to processing module 3 carries out reporting to the police is reported to the police.
Preferably, touch control detection module 2 is resistance touch screen or capacitive touch screen or infrared touch screen.
Preferably, alarm module 6 is LED warning lamp, loudspeaker or Vib..
Preferably, processing module 3 is micro-control DSP or micro-control ARM.
Further, door lock main frame 5 comprises:
Key production module 51, for generating login key, random number, and according to generating random number data key;
Data encryption module 52, is encrypted described random number and data key with login key, after door lock main frame 5 and Intelligent key complete authentication, is encrypted with data key dual lock password meanwhile;
Transport module 53, for being sent to Intelligent key by the random number after login key, encryption and the data key after encryption;
Authentication module 54, for according to login key, random number and data key, completes the authentication between Intelligent key;
Transport module 53 is also for being sent to Intelligent key by the unlocking cipher after encryption;
To unblank module 55, for respond it is received decipher through Intelligent key the unlocking cipher obtained, unlock door lock.
Further, data encryption module 52 comprises:
First data encryption module 521, for being encrypted random number with login key;
Second data encryption module 522, for being encrypted data key with login key.
Further, authentication module 54 comprises:
First authentication module 541, deciphers through Intelligent key the random number obtained verify for what receives door lock main frame 5;
Second authentication module 542, deciphers through Intelligent key the data key obtained verify for what receives door lock main frame 5.
Preferably, transport module 53 is the transport module that is combined with wireless low frequency of wireless high-frequency or Bluetooth communication modules or WiFi transport module.
